Latest Audit Report Highlights Gaps in Allergen Compliance with 53% Pass Rates

Serve Legal’s latest audit reveals a concerning drop in allergen compliance – now at 53% by 2025. Despite increasing awareness and efforts to improve allergen labelling, food businesses still face challenges with consistent staff training and real-time application of allergen protocols, putting consumers at risk. Simple Packaging Boosts Recycling Rates

Recent research shows that simple is best when it comes to recycling. Packaging made from a single material such as drinks cans, glass bottles and cardboard boxes are some of the most recycled items in the UK, with 81% of aluminium beverage cans and 69.8% of glass now being recycled according to Environment Agency data.  This is […]
